Transaction 85da4568c4502407736ae1f490a063b7a71a2ec734142364867a6a5897a1cf0a

124 Input
2 Outputs
  • 85da4568c4502407736ae1f490a063b7a71a2ec734142364867a6a5897a1cf0a:0
  • value  287222
    address  1FgRM663D4ncgpDNEG2YCgawzhEzW8XWSZ
  • 85da4568c4502407736ae1f490a063b7a71a2ec734142364867a6a5897a1cf0a:1
  • value  33863499
    address  3527ESusFQxh3y88q2ePUnip632TKW1Bwg